Key Features of China's Best Front Windows for Global Markets

China's front windows are steadily gaining traction in global markets. They boast unique features that appeal to diverse buyers. High-quality materials and innovative manufacturing processes set these windows apart. According to industry reports, 48% of architects prioritize energy efficiency in window design. China’s windows often meet or exceed these standards.

One standout characteristic is the use of low-emissivity (Low-E) glass. This glass reflects heat while allowing light. Data from the Glass Association indicates that Low-E windows can improve energy efficiency by up to 30%. This feature greatly reduces heating and cooling costs, making them an attractive option for homeowners and businesses alike.

However, challenges remain. Some manufacturers may overlook quality control, resulting in inconsistent products. Additionally, the environmental impact of production processes raises questions. As global buyers seek sustainable options, producers must adapt their practices. Continuous improvement in quality and sustainability will be crucial for maintaining competitiveness in foreign markets.

Quality Standards and Certifications of Chinese Front Windows

Chinese front windows are gaining traction among global buyers, thanks to their adherence to rigorous quality standards. Many manufacturers comply with ISO 9001, ensuring consistent quality management. The adherence to such standards reflects a commitment to product reliability. According to a recent market analysis, over 70% of buyers prioritize safety and durability when choosing windows.

Moreover, certifications like CE and ASTM play a vital role. These certifications demonstrate that products meet international safety and performance benchmarks. Research shows that companies with these certifications report fewer defects and higher customer satisfaction. It's essential for buyers to verify these standards when considering their purchases.

However, not all products meet these quality benchmarks consistently. There are still variations in quality control processes across different manufacturers. Some may not regularly update their certifications, raising concerns about product integrity. Buyers must conduct thorough research and possibly seek expert opinions to make informed decisions. These factors highlight the complexity and challenges in navigating the global front window market.
